When is a cream pie not a cream pie
Fri, 05/2/08 4:59 PM
( permalink)
When it's topped with meringue! Conversely, when is a Key Lime pie not a Key Lime Pie? When it is not topped with meringue. I happen to hate meringue. But, Key Lime pie is traditionalyl made with meringue. But, if you are from up north, oru cream pies have legitimate whipped cream or mystery topping, but not meringue. I've noticed too many places down South call their pies.."cream pies" and yet there is not a trace of whipped cream anywhere to be found. Where's the cream in their chocolate cream pie? Are they saying the milk they've added to make the pudding justifies calling it a cream pie? Sorry, I don't get it. To me, a banana cream or chocolate cream pie has to have real whipped cream as the topping. But, serve it with a mystery topping, if you must. The best banana cream pie I have ever had was at the Buckhead Diner in Atlanta. But, I hear Emerill's version at several of his dining spots is pretty darn good.
